CFP® Professional In the Money Retirement is a full-time fiduciary. We adhere to the definition of fiduciary under the Investment Advisers Act of 1940, the fiduciary guidelines under the CFP Board, and being fee-only to meet the standards set by NAPFA, the National Association of Personal Financial Advisors. Beware, some advisors are held to a fiduciary standard only when offering advice and not when implementing the advice (selling you products). These are known as fee-based or dually-registered advisors. If you see “securities offered through…Member SIPC, FINRA” at the bottom of an advisor’s website, it means they get paid to sell you products. This is very different from our fee-only business model.
